SRI LANKA | Marriott has partnered with Ventive Hospitality for a landmark seven-hotel deal comprising 1548 keys across five brands.
Marriott International, Inc. announced it has signed an agreement with Ventive Hospitality to open seven hotels, as part of a portfolio deal comprising 1,548-keys across five brands. This includes multiple brand debuts with a Ritz-Carlton Reserve in Sri Lanka, Marriott Hotels & Resorts in Varanasi, Courtyard by Marriott in Mundra (Gujarat) and Moxy in Pune. Additionally, it will mark the third JW Marriott and second Moxy to open as part of a dual-branded property in Mumbai. A premier division of Panchshil Realty, Ventive Hospitality stands at the forefront as a visionary owner, developer and asset manager of luxury and business hotels and resorts. With a strong foothold in Pune and the Maldives, the company is recognised for curating remarkable experiences defined by landmark properties, sustainable practices, and strategic growth. All seven properties are anticipated to open in 2030.
The multi-deal agreement was signed by Rajeev Menon, President, Asia Pacific excluding China, Marriott International and Atul Chordia, Chairman and Executive Director, Ventive Hospitality Ltd.
